ShiftyLook is set to shut down this month, the Namco Bandai owned studio has announced. The company, formed in 2011, had been tasked with breathing new life into old Namco Bandai game characters across a number of media forms, including web comics, animation, games and merchandise. What is being described as the next-generation iteration of Blu-ray” has been revealed by Sony. GameSpot reports that the new ‘Archival Disc’ will eventually hold up to 1TB of information, although the first versions of the format – arriving summer 2015 – will offer 300GB of storage.
